"Magic Town" is a popular song first written in 1965 by songwriters Barry Mann and Cynthia Weil, and originally performed by The Vogues.
The song is about one man who initially has dreams and aspirations about living in the city, but soon learns that doing so isn't what he expected.
This song was a fairly big hit, despite only peaking at #22 on Billboard's Hot 100 chart shortly after its' initial release as a single on Co & Ce Records.
However, the song did not make an appearance on LP until "The Vogues' Greatest Hits" was released in 1970, featuring a rather unique string overlay used on top of the original single version conducted by bandleader Ernie Freeman.
